ITPub博客

首页 > Linux操作系统 > Linux操作系统 > 数据文件丢失如何恢复

数据文件丢失如何恢复

原创 Linux操作系统 作者:lfree 时间:2005-04-14 00:00:00 0 删除 编辑
摘要: 数据文件丢失如何恢复,内容来自以下讨论:

http://www.itpub.net/348275.html

数据库归档模式,新建表空间testtbs, 数据文件testtbs.dbf
关闭数据库
删除数据文件testtbs.dbf
启动数据库

提示:ORA-01157: 无法标识/锁定数据文件 2 - 请参阅 DBWR 跟踪文件
ORA-01110: 数据文件 2: 'D:ORACLEORADATAHAHATESTTBS.DBF'

此数据文件没有做任何备份, 请问这种情况怎么恢复

操作如下:

SQL> alter database datafile 2 offline drop;
数据库已更改。
SQL> alter database open;
数据库已更改。
SQL> alter database create datafile 'D:ORACLEORADATAHAHATESTTBS.DBF';
SQL> recover datafile 2;
完成介质恢复。
SQL> alter tablespace testtbs online;
表空间已更改。



来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/267265/viewspace-82781/,如需转载,请注明出处,否则将追究法律责任。

下一篇: 踢球记
请登录后发表评论 登录
全部评论
熟悉oracle相关技术,擅长sql优化,rman备份与恢复,熟悉linux shell编程。

注册时间:2008-01-03

  • 博文量
    2485
  • 访问量
    6292724